Because iBUYPOWER systems are often shipped long distances, internal components can shift during transit. A common reason for a "no-power" state is a loose 24-pin motherboard connector or a disconnected front panel header. The front panel header is the thin wire that connects the physical power button to the motherboard; if it slips off its pins, the button becomes useless. Reseating the RAM modules and the graphics card is also a standard "first-aid" step, as poorly seated memory can prevent the system from completing its Power-On Self-Test (POST). The most common culprits are often the simplest. Before assuming a hardware defect, one must verify the external power environment. This includes ensuring the power cable is firmly seated in both the wall outlet and the Power Supply Unit (PSU). Crucially, iBUYPOWER systems feature a master I/O switch on the back of the case; if this is in the "O" (Off) position instead of the "I" (On) position, the system will remain dormant regardless of the front power button.
